inapp_notification.py 文件源码

python
阅读 25 收藏 0 点赞 0 评论 0

项目:Gnome-Authenticator 作者: bil-elmoussaoui 项目源码 文件源码
def generate_components(self):
        self.get_style_context().add_class("top")
        self.infobar = Gtk.InfoBar()
        self.infobar.set_show_close_button(True)
        self.infobar.connect("response", self.response)
        self.infobar.set_default_response(Gtk.ResponseType.CLOSE)
        self.infobar.set_message_type(Gtk.MessageType.INFO)

        content_area = self.infobar.get_content_area()
        action_area = self.infobar.get_action_area()
        self.undo_button = None
        if self.undo_action:
            self.undo_button = self.infobar.add_button(
                _("Undo"), Gtk.ResponseType.CANCEL)

        self.message_label = Gtk.Label()
        self.message_label.set_text(self.message)

        content_area.add(self.message_label)
        self.add(self.infobar)
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号